The image presents a close-up view of three caps of tooth mushrooms (Irpex subrawakensis) situated on a fallen oak branch in Lick Creek Park, College Station, Texas. The caps are characterized by their light brown color and irregularly shaped edges, which appear slightly wavy or lobed. The caps' surfaces display small cracks or fissures.

The caps are positioned on top of the oak branch, with some partially overlapping each other. In the background, a layer of dark brown soil is visible underneath the caps.
